Commercial Fleet Service Manager - Ford Westborough

Salary Range $130-150K comprised of base + commission

Do you have a passion for developing talent, providing exceptional guest experiences, and being an innovator in the automotive industry? As a Service Manager, you will have the opportunity to make a positive impact on our business and in the lives of our team members and customers every day. We are looking for an energetic, customer-focused Service Manager who will help us redefine the car-buying/service experience.The Service Manager is responsible for creating and maintaining a high level of customer satisfaction and coordinating resolution of customer conflicts in a manner that does not unduly compromise the customer's interest, while maintaining appropriate attention to department profits. He or she is also responsible for recruiting, supervising and training of the team members. The position also requires the ability to establish and maintain a good working relationship with all dealership personnel, members of his/her team, and other employees in the department. Periodic, effective performance evaluations of all department personnel are required

Greet customers in a timely, friendly manner and obtain pertinent vehicle informationActively promote and build rapport with the customerAdvise customers on the care and the value of maintaining their vehicles in accordance with manufacturers' specificationsGenerate and provide customer with a complete and accurate estimate of repairEstablish and communicate completion time of repair with customer and technicianAnswer incoming service callsMaintain and schedule service appointmentsFollow prescribed procedures for customer post follow-up resulting in return visits, increased sales and admirable CSI (Customer Satisfaction Index)Strictly follow the manufacturer's warranty guidelines and proceduresConduct business in an honest manner that maintains the manufacturer Customer Satisfaction Index (CSI) at or above Asbury's specified goal(s) in service for district, regional and national scoresComply with all federal, state and local laws, and company policy, regarding the safeguarding all customer, company and manufacturer information, as well as customers vehicle and propertyMust be able to manage in a fast paced work environment with limited supervisionMust have great customer service, phone and computer skillsPrevious automotive service experience requiredMust be a minimum of eighteen years of ageMust have a valid driver's licenseMust be able to pass pre-employment screening (background & drug test)
